Many of the MSI coupon codes will mistakenly provide additional discounts to other items in your cart. You can play around with them but they tend to notice when approving the orders if the discount is crazy and their fix seems to be disabling the code.

Quote from phrodini :
Are there issues with order from msi?
It is a great place to buy stuff just keep these things in mind.

1) It is not Amazon you wont get your order in the next 2 or 3 days. In fact it might not ship for 2 or 3 weeks.

2) It is not Amazon don't buy things unless you are sure you won't change your mind and want to return it. They are not going to be keen on you returning opened products. Opened or not expect the shipping costs to be deducted from your refund in the event of a buyer's remorse return.

3) It is one of the cheapest places to buy a CPU by bundling with one of their motherboards.
That CPU is not a retail chip warrantied by AMD but rather an OEM chip sold in bulk to prebuilt PC builders. MSI is the one providing that built system (or in this case just the CPU & mobo bundle) with a warranty. They are going to be less generous than AMD would be if you fry it.

4) Many purchases you can get a 10% discount if you have access to a .edu email. That makes them even more competive with discounts you would get at Microcenter/Newegg/Amazon for using their in house credit cards.

5) Many MSI products purchased either on their site or from any other authorized dealer are eligible for promotions where you get a code for Steam currency when registering the product.
